9// CodeGenMapTable provides functionality for the TabelGen to create
10// relation mapping between instructions. Relation models are defined using
11// InstrMapping as a base class. This file implements the functionality which
12// parses these definitions and generates relation maps using the information
13// specified there. These maps are emitted as tables in the XXXGenInstrInfo.inc
14// file along with the functions to query them.
15//
16// A relationship model to relate non-predicate instructions with their
17// predicated true/false forms can be defined as follows:
18//
19// def getPredOpcode : InstrMapping {
20// let FilterClass = "PredRel";
21// let RowFields = ["BaseOpcode"];
22// let ColFields = ["PredSense"];
23// let KeyCol = ["none"];
24// let ValueCols = [["true"], ["false"]]; }
25//
26// CodeGenMapTable parses this map and generates a table in XXXGenInstrInfo.inc
27// file that contains the instructions modeling this relationship. This table
28// is defined in the function
29// "int getPredOpcode(uint16_t Opcode, enum PredSense inPredSense)"
30// that can be used to retrieve the predicated form of the instruction by
31// passing its opcode value and the predicate sense (true/false) of the desired
32// instruction as arguments.
33//
34// Short description of the algorithm:
35//
36// 1) Iterate through all the records that derive from "InstrMapping" class.
37// 2) For each record, filter out instructions based on the FilterClass value.
38// 3) Iterate through this set of instructions and insert them into
39// RowInstrMap map based on their RowFields values. RowInstrMap is keyed by the
40// vector of RowFields values and contains vectors of Records (instructions) as
41// values. RowFields is a list of fields that are required to have the same
42// values for all the instructions appearing in the same row of the relation
43// table. All the instructions in a given row of the relation table have some
44// sort of relationship with the key instruction defined by the corresponding
45// relationship model.
46//
47// Ex: RowInstrMap(RowVal1, RowVal2, ...) -> [Instr1, Instr2, Instr3, ... ]
48// Here Instr1, Instr2, Instr3 have same values (RowVal1, RowVal2) for
49// RowFields. These groups of instructions are later matched against ValueCols
50// to determine the column they belong to, if any.
51//
52// While building the RowInstrMap map, collect all the key instructions in
53// KeyInstrVec. These are the instructions having the same values as KeyCol
54// for all the fields listed in ColFields.
55//
56// For Example:
57//
58// Relate non-predicate instructions with their predicated true/false forms.
59//
60// def getPredOpcode : InstrMapping {
61// let FilterClass = "PredRel";
62// let RowFields = ["BaseOpcode"];
63// let ColFields = ["PredSense"];
64// let KeyCol = ["none"];
65// let ValueCols = [["true"], ["false"]]; }
66//
67// Here, only instructions that have "none" as PredSense will be selected as key
68// instructions.
69//
70// 4) For each key instruction, get the group of instructions that share the
71// same key-value as the key instruction from RowInstrMap. Iterate over the list
72// of columns in ValueCols (it is defined as a list<list<string> >. Therefore,
73// it can specify multi-column relationships). For each column, find the
74// instruction from the group that matches all the values for the column.
75// Multiple matches are not allowed.
76//
